Vascular pythiosis is a rare, neglected, life-threatening disease with mortality of 100% in patients with incomplete surgical resection or patients with persistently elevated serum ß-d-glucan (BDG). The study was conducted to understand the clinical outcomes of new treatment protocols and potential use of erythrocyte sedimentation rate (ESR) and c-reactive protein (CRP) as alternative monitoring tools, given recent favorable minimum inhibitory concentrations (MICs) of antibacterial agents and prohibitive cost of serum BDG in Thailand. A prospective cohort study of patients with vascular pythiosis was conducted between February 2019 and August 2020. After diagnosis, patients were followed at 0.5, 1, 1.5, 3, and 6 months. Descriptive statistics, Spearman's correlation coefficient, and general linear model for longitudinal data were used. Amongst the cohort of ten vascular pythiosis patients, four had residual disease after surgery. Among four with residual disease, one developed disseminated disease and died, one developed relapse disease requiring surgery, and two were successfully managed with antimicrobial agents. The spearman's correlation coefficients between BDG and ESR, and between BDG and CRP in patients without relapse or disseminated disease were 0.65 and 0.60, respectively. Tetracyclines and macrolides had most favorable minimum inhibitory concentrations and synergistic effects were observed in combinations of these two antibiotic classes. Adjunctive use of azithromycin and doxycycline preliminarily improved survival in vascular pythiosis patients with residual disease. Further studies are needed to understand the trends of ESR and CRP in this population.

INTRODUCTION: Omental torsion is an unusual cause of acute abdominal pain. This condition may mimic other common pathologies, for instance, appendicitis or colonic diverticulitis. As a result, the diagnosis of omental torsion could be challenging to achieve preoperatively. PRESENTATION OF CASE: A 63-year-old male patient of secondary omental torsion accompanied by the left inguinal hernia was described. The patient presented to the hospital with a painful mass occupying in the left lower quadrant of his abdomen. A computed tomography scan with intravenous contrast administration demonstrated a whirling sign of intraabdominal fatty mass extending to the left inguinal canal. Therefore, emergency laparotomy was performed. Hemorrhagic infarction of the greater omentum was observed, and double-twisting points were identified at both ends of the greater omentum. Then, the strangulated omental portion was resected. The patient recovered uneventfully and was able to be discharged home on postoperative day 4. DISCUSSION: Secondary omental torsion has been reported more frequently than primary omental torsion. However, most of the patients were right-sided torsion. Precise diagnosis might not be possible by only clinical examination and plain abdominal radiography. The computed tomography scan, demonstrating classic whirling pattern, is useful in suspected cases. The treatment was straightforward by resection of the affected omentum. CONCLUSION: The omental torsion is a rare cause of acute abdominal pain and could mimic other intra-abdominal pathologies.
